    You can find some terrific gas grills at your local hardware store and an especially dizzying array of options at Home Depot and Lowe’s. Then there’s Walmart and other discount stores, which ring up about a quarter of all grill sales. Walmart’s broad gas grill offerings span its walk-in and online stores, with dozens of free delivery options.

    In this article Arrow link
    More on Grills

    “Walmart stores usually offer gas grills that are around $100 to $400, from brands such as Cuisinart and Expert Grill,” says Nish Suvarnakar, the senior market analyst who oversees grills at Consumer Reports. “Online, you have a lot more to choose from, including Weber, with prices all the way up to $2,000.”

    If Walmart is your go-to store, this guide will help you narrow your selection. We even highlight the worst gas grill we’ve tested that’s sold at Walmart (and why you should avoid it).

    Lowest-Scoring Grill at Walmart

    The small Royal Gourmet GA5404H performs adequately in a variety of tests but gets a failing grade for how evenly the heat spreads across the grill’s surface at the highest and lowest setting, plus the evenness of the grill’s surface after 10 minutes of preheating. We recommend looking at other models on this list available. Here are some takeaways from our testing:

    • Its evenness performance is terrible.
    • Its temperature range, preheat performance, and indirect cooking scores are middling, but passable.
    • Although this grill is less likely to flare up with high-fat-content foods, a full grill may still flare up.
    • We don’t have scores for its predicted reliability or owner satisfaction.

    Grill Shopping Tips

    To make sure we test the same grills that are available to you, Consumer Reports’ secret shoppers purchase each one either in a store or online. Here’s their checklist for making your grill shopping a smooth experience:

    • Check inventory online before you head to a store. The grill you want might be in a store near you. If not, Walmart will ship it to a store where you can pick it up and you won’t have to pay a shipping fee.
    • Check the grill’s dimensions. You can do this on Walmart’s site or on the grill’s summary page in our gas grill ratings.
    • Check your cargo space. Walmart offers free assembly but doesn’t deliver assembled grills to residences. You’ll need an SUV or a pickup to haul an assembled grill home. Walmart doesn’t rent trucks.
    • Check the box before you start assembling the grill. Make sure all the parts are included and aren’t broken or damaged. If something is missing, call Walmart’s customer service (800-925-6278). If the wait for a replacement part is too long, call the manufacturer directly to see whether it can be shipped sooner.
